原文:MongoDB 索引相关知识

背景: MongoDB和MySQL一样,都会产生慢查询,所以都需要对其进行优化:包括创建索引 重构查询等。现在就说明在MongoDB下的索引相关知识点,可以通过这篇文章MongoDB 查询优化分析了解MongoDB慢查询的一些特点。 执行计划分析: 因为MongoDB也是BTree索引,所以使用上和MySQL大致一样。通过explain查看一个query的执行计划,来判断如何加索引,explain ...

2015-07-22 10:21 2 8879 推荐指数:

查看详情

索引相关知识

索引 为什么使用索引 ​ 一般的应用系统,读写比例在10:1左右,而且插入操作和一般的更新操作很少出现性能问题,在生产环境中,我们遇到最多的,也是最容易出问题的,还是一些复杂的查询操作,因此对查询语句的优化显然是重中之重。说起加速查询,就不得不提到索引了。 ​ 索引的目的在于提高查询效率 ...

Thu Jan 02 02:21:00 CST 2020 1 4099
MySQL表及索引相关知识

1.表 1.1)建表 create table student( id int(4) not null,name char(20) not null,age tinyint(2) not nul ...

Thu Sep 06 23:17:00 CST 2018 0 958
MongoDb 相关

本文地址:http://www.cnblogs.com/vnii/archive/2012/08/23/2652891.html 1.C#下对MongoDB中的数据分组Group 2.C#操作MongoDB的部分代码示例 3.命令行下语法 ...

Fri Aug 24 01:50:00 CST 2012 0 9366
Mongodb索引

引言 从今年年初开始接触Mongodb,就一直被如何建立最合理的索引这个问题折磨着,没办法,应用中的筛选条件太复杂。而关于Mongodb索引方面的中文资料并不多,所以只能在google上找找资料,然后就匆忙的开始用了。成长很曲折,也充满了惊喜,结合最近读的《Mongodb实战 ...

Fri Nov 30 20:55:00 CST 2012 3 2246
mongodb索引

Note:mongodb索引算法主要是btree和hash算法,mongodb默认采用的是btree索引算法。 1、索引 2、索引分类 3、常用索引命令: 后续有应用,将继续补充,同时欢迎大家留言,一起学习、进步。 ...

Tue Dec 18 17:53:00 CST 2018 0 1285
mongoDB 索引

索引的介绍 1、索引(indexes)帮助mongoDB提高执行查询的效率 2、没有索引MongoDB必须执行集合扫描,即扫描集合中的每个文档,以选择与查询语句匹配的文档。 3、如果查询存在适当的索引,则MongoDB可以使用该索引来限制它必须检查的文档数量。 4、索引是特殊的数据结构 ...

Wed May 03 20:10:00 CST 2017 0 1674
MongoDB 索引

索引是用来加快查询的,数据库索引与数据的索引类似,有了索引就不需要翻遍整本书,数据库可以直接在索引中查找, 使得查询速度很快,在索引中找到条目后,就可以直接跳转到目标文档的位置. 1.索引简介 要掌握如何为查询配置最佳索引会有些难度. MongoDB索引几乎和关系型数据库的索引一样.绝大 ...

Wed Aug 01 17:39:00 CST 2012 1 7772
MongoDB索引

Index 定义 索引,一个单独的、存储在磁盘上的数据结构 mongodb索引采用 B-tree 数据结构存储 易于遍历,支持相等匹配和范围查询 存储字段的值以及指向其所在文档的指针 包含集合中所有文档的指针(包含数据表中所有记录的引用指针 ...

Sun Aug 30 18:29:00 CST 2020 0 441
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M